我需要实现一个具有密集数学计算的算法。 Java 中是否已经对此提供了支持?或者是否有任何第 3 方供应商提供此支持?
最佳答案
JavaCalc可能与您的需求相关
Goal
The main goal of this project is to develop a symbolic library for Java that can handle regular algebraic expressions as well as standard calculus functions. Specifically, the library should support:• Parsing standard algebraic expressions (syntax tree) from a string.
• Simplifying algebraic expressions (factoring, common denominator, trigonometric identities, etc).
• Applying symbolic standard calculus functions (differentiation, integration) to algebraic expressions.
• Common calculus tools (Taylor series, limits, numerical approximations).
• Graphing tools (using swing).
• If time permits, differential equation support (symbolic solver, Euler's approximation, Laplace transform).
关于java - 是否有任何内置 API 用于解决复杂的数学问题,如积分和微分,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/3728507/